Easter baskets aren’t just for little kids anymore. Everyone young and old will appreciate a thoughtful and nicely crafted basket of goodies. To get your imagination and creativity flowing, here are a few Easter basket ideas for every age group, and all can easily be put together for under $10 at one dollar zone. Kids are easy to buy for, but there are Easter basket ideas for tweens, Easter basket ideas for men, and even non-candy Easter basket ideas here too.

  • Infants and toddlers – Baskets full of candy might not be a good idea for this age group, they’ve got plenty of energy already. A little bit won’t hurt, but you don’t have to include any at all. Look for miniature stuffed toys, rattles, pacifiers, fruit baby food, sippy cups, plastic eggs, coloring books, and larger toys for the toddlers such as, playdough, jigsaw puzzles, games, coloring books, crayons, markers, stickers, action figures and dolls.
  • Older kids and tweensCandy of all kinds is appropriate for this group, and one dollar zone carries your favorite brands like, Lindt, Hershey’s and Mars. Other great items for Easter baskets are toys, games, sidewalk chalk, and snacks. The tweens will appreciate makeup and beauty supplies, cologne, books, games, and items they can use for school.
  • Teens It may seem hard to create teen Easter baskets but it is easier than you think! You need to include candy and snacks in their basket so they can have some snacks while watching Netflix. Hair care, nail polish, and makeup will be appreciated by the girls. Boys will like cologne, items for their car, things they can throw in their backpack like gum, mints and hair gel, and tools to store in their trunk. Some other great options are small notebooks, extra pens and pencils, fashion accessories, cell phone cases, cell phone chargers, phone screen protectors, small picture frames, and of course jewelry. At this age, it’s a great idea to include practical items along with the candy.
  • Adults – The women will love soothing bath salts and soaps, moisturizers, body creams, loofahs and bubble bath, and cosmetics. Men will like handy stuff like tools, super glue, cologne, books, cell phone chargers and new socks. Of course, even adults like candy – don’t forget to add some to their baskets.
